Functionalism
A theoretical framework in psychology that emphasizes the roles and purposes of mind and behavior in adapting to the environment.
Edward Titchener
A British psychologist who is best known for developing the theory of structuralism and for his use of introspection in psychological research.
Behaviorism
A theory of learning based on the idea that all behaviors are acquired through conditioning without considering thoughts or feelings.
Cognitive Neuroscience
Cognitive neuroscience is the academic field that studies the biological processes and aspects that underlie cognition, with a specific focus on the neural connections in the brain.
